What Features Should You Consider When Choosing the Best Suction Robot Vacuum?

When choosing the best suction robot vacuum, you should consider several key features that impact performance and usability.

  • Suction Power: The suction power determines how effectively the robot can pick up dirt, debris, and pet hair from various surfaces. Look for models that specify their suction strength in Pascals (Pa) or air watts, as higher values typically indicate better cleaning capabilities.
  • Advanced navigation systems, such as Lidar or cameras, allow the vacuum to map your home and clean efficiently without missing spots. This technology helps the robot avoid obstacles and navigate around furniture, ensuring a thorough cleaning process.
  • Battery Life: The battery life affects how long the robot can operate before needing a recharge, which is crucial for larger homes. Consider vacuums that offer longer runtimes, ideally over 90 minutes, and check if they automatically return to their charging stations when the battery runs low.
  • A larger dustbin means less frequent emptying, making the vacuum more convenient to use. Choose a model with a dustbin size that fits your cleaning needs, especially if you have pets or a lot of foot traffic in your home.
  • Smart Features: Many modern robot vacuums come equipped with smart features such as app control, voice commands, and scheduling options. These functionalities provide added convenience, allowing you to control your vacuum remotely or set it to clean while you are away.
  • Filtration System: A good filtration system is essential for trapping allergens and fine dust particles, making it especially important for allergy sufferers. Look for vacuums with HEPA filters, as they can capture 99.97% of dust, pollen, and other airborne particles.
  • Surface Compatibility: Ensure the vacuum is designed to clean a variety of surfaces, such as carpets, hardwood, and tile. Some models may struggle on thick carpets or may not transition smoothly between different floor types, so check reviews for performance on your specific surfaces.
  • Obstacle Detection: Effective obstacle detection technology helps the vacuum avoid falling down stairs and bumping into furniture. Look for features like cliff sensors and soft bumpers, which can prevent damage to both the vacuum and your home while ensuring a safe cleaning experience.
  • Noise Level: The noise level of the vacuum can be a significant factor, especially in homes with pets or small children. Check the decibel rating, and consider choosing a model designed for quieter operation to avoid disturbances during cleaning times.

What Common Problems Might You Encounter with Suction Robot Vacuums?

Battery life limitations are significant because most suction robot vacuums operate on rechargeable batteries that may only allow for a certain number of cleaning sessions before needing to be charged. Users might find that their vacuum cannot complete cleaning a large area in one go, necessitating multiple charging cycles.

Clogging and debris buildup is a common concern, especially in homes with pets. Hair and dust can quickly accumulate in the brushes and suction ports, requiring regular cleaning and maintenance to ensure optimal performance and prevent overheating.

Inconsistent suction power often results from filter clogging or a full dustbin, which can significantly affect the vacuum’s ability to pick up dirt and debris efficiently. Regularly checking and maintaining these components is essential to keep the vacuum performing well.

Floor type compatibility can limit the effectiveness of a suction robot vacuum, especially on carpets with deep piles or uneven surfaces, where it may struggle to maintain adequate suction. Users should consider their flooring types when selecting a vacuum to ensure it meets their cleaning needs.

Smart home integration challenges can detract from the user experience, as some vacuums require specific apps or compatibility with home assistants. Difficulties in setup or connectivity may lead to frustration and limit the benefits of smart features like scheduling and remote control.

How Can You Properly Maintain Your Suction Robot Vacuum for Optimal Performance?

Proper maintenance of your suction robot vacuum ensures it operates efficiently and has a longer lifespan.

  • Regular Cleaning of Brushes: Keeping the brushes free of hair, dirt, and debris is crucial for maintaining suction power.
  • Emptying the Dustbin: Frequently emptying the dustbin prevents clogs and ensures that the vacuum maintains optimal suction.
  • Checking and Replacing Filters: The filters trap dust and allergens, so checking them regularly and replacing them as needed is vital for air quality and efficiency.
  • Inspecting Wheels and Sensors: Regularly inspecting the wheels and sensors ensures that the vacuum navigates smoothly and avoids obstacles effectively.
  • Updating Software: Keeping the vacuum’s software up to date can improve its performance and introduce new features.

Regular Cleaning of Brushes: Brushes can accumulate hair and debris, which can hinder their performance and affect the vacuum’s ability to pick up dirt. Regularly removing and cleaning the brushes helps maintain their effectiveness and ensures the vacuum can perform at its best.

Emptying the Dustbin: A full dustbin can cause the vacuum to lose suction and may even lead to motor strain. To prevent these issues, it is recommended to empty the dustbin after each use or when it reaches the maximum fill line.

Checking and Replacing Filters: Filters can become clogged over time, reducing airflow and suction power. Regularly checking the filters and replacing them as per the manufacturer’s recommendations not only maintains suction but also improves air quality in your home.

Inspecting Wheels and Sensors: The wheels of a robot vacuum should be free from obstructions to navigate effectively. Additionally, ensuring that the sensors are clean and functional helps the vacuum avoid obstacles and follow its cleaning path accurately.

Updating Software: Many modern suction robot vacuums come with app connectivity that allows for software updates. Regularly updating the software can enhance functionality, improve navigation algorithms, and add new cleaning features, ensuring the vacuum continues to perform optimally.
